      <title>Dreadful experience!</title>
      <link>http://www.travelpost.com//hotels/Canal_Street_Hotel_French_Quarter_New_Orleans_-_Superdome_Area/r368998</link>
      <description>This was the most dreadful hotel experience that I've ever had. I'm not picky (I have gone back-packing and have stayed in hostels many times) and don't ask for luxury in the hotels that I book, I'm perfectly satisfied with a clean room and a shower that works.&#xD;
I booked a room at Canal Street Hotel for a conference in early January 2008.&#xD;
When I arrived at the hotel, it seemed pretty run down and not very well maintained, which was surprising, given the advertisement of renovations after Katrina. I got into my room exhausted from a long trip and already late for the conference, and when I turned on the light, I noticed a big cockroach half-dead (still moving) on the floor. When I told the staff, they started laughing, and even though they removed the cockroach, they didn't even bother giving me another room or upgrading my reservation. In fact, I don't even remember them apologizing! I tried to convince myself that it was an isolated event, but in the next couple of days I saw more, smaller cockroaches in the corridors. &#xD;
Besides the cockroaches, the linen on the bed were really old, and my blanket was dirty and had holes in it, which looked like they were caused by some insect. &#xD;
My opinion did not improve when on my second night there, some drunk guys were really noisy and kept knocking on my door at 4 or 5am.&#xD;
The staff was not very helpful in general, and when I tried calling them before arriving they kept putting me on hold for so long, that I needed to hang up. During my stay in the hotel every time that I walked past the front desk there were dissatisfied guests arguing with the receptionist. As I was waiting for a taxi to take me to airport when my conference was over, a bunch of policemen came in the building and went to the back of the hotel. I have never been more eager to leave a place.&#xD;
Please stay away!</description>
